Licensing and Certifications: A Critical Review

A key aspect of vetting any contractor, especially for large-scale construction projects like pools and outdoor living spaces, is confirming their licensing, certifications, and insurance. Motruckinginc.com Review

This information is crucial for consumer protection, ensuring that the company operates legally, adheres to industry standards, and is financially responsible in case of accidents or project issues.

Unfortunately, Richardstbs.com’s homepage text does not provide any explicit details regarding these vital credentials.

Importance of Licensing

Contractor licensing is a legal requirement in many jurisdictions, including various cities and counties within Texas, where Richardstbs.com operates.

A valid license indicates that the contractor has met specific state or local requirements, which may include:

  • Passing examinations: Demonstrating knowledge of construction codes, safety regulations, and business practices.
  • Financial stability: Showing proof of bonding or financial capability.
  • Background checks: Ensuring the contractor has no disqualifying criminal history.

Missing Information: The absence of a license number or a statement about being licensed by the relevant Texas authorities e.g.,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ation if applicable, though pool contractors often fall under local municipal licensing is a significant oversight. For a company claiming “Over 40 years in business,” one would expect this fundamental information to be readily available on their public-facing website. Productplan.com Review

Value of Industry Certifications

Beyond basic licensing, industry-specific certifications demonstrate a contractor’s commitment to excellence, ongoing education, and adherence to best practices. For the pool and spa industry, prominent organizations like the Pool & Hot Tub Alliance PHTA offer various certifications e.g., Certified Building Professional, Certified Service Professional.

  • PHTA Certification: Professionals with PHTA certifications have typically undergone rigorous training and passed exams covering design, construction, safety, and water chemistry. This indicates a higher level of expertise and professionalism.
  • Benefits to Consumers: Hiring a certified professional can lead to better quality construction, safer installations, and compliance with industry standards, potentially reducing future problems.

Missing Information: Richardstbs.com states they are “Award-Winning” and use “industry-leading knowledge” but does not explicitly mention any certifications from organizations like PHTA. While awards are positive, certifications offer a more concrete measure of professional competence and adherence to standards.

Necessity of Insurance

Proper insurance coverage is non-negotiable for any construction project. Contractors should carry:

  • General Liability Insurance: Protects the homeowner from property damage or injuries that occur due to the contractor’s work.
  • Worker’s Compensation Insurance: Covers the contractor’s employees if they are injured on the job, preventing homeowners from being held liable.

Missing Information: There is no mention of insurance coverage on Richardstbs.com’s homepage. This is a critical piece of information for any homeowner, as its absence leaves them potentially vulnerable to significant financial risk if an accident occurs during the project.

The Impact of Missing Information

The lack of transparent information regarding licensing, certifications, and insurance on Richardstbs.com’s homepage necessitates that potential clients actively inquire about these details during their initial consultation. Dragobike.com Review

While a reputable company might provide this information upon request, its absence online can create an initial perception of less-than-complete transparency.

For a consumer, this means an extra layer of due diligence is required to ensure they are dealing with a fully legitimate, qualified, and protected contractor.

Always verify these credentials independently where possible, perhaps through state licensing boards or by requesting certificates of insurance directly from their provider.

The Need for a Detailed Proposal

Richardstbs.com does state, “We’ll provide a detailed proposal including a detailed breakdown of the final cost.” This is a positive step, as a comprehensive proposal is essential for any construction project.

However, the onus is entirely on the client to initiate contact to receive this information.

  • What a detailed proposal should include:
    • Line-item breakdown of costs: Materials, labor, permits, equipment.
    • Payment schedule: Milestones and associated payments.
    • Project timeline: Start and estimated completion dates, key phases.
    • Specific materials and finishes: Brands, colors, textures.
    • Warranty information: Details on guarantees for work and equipment.
    • Change order process: How modifications to the scope are handled.

For a customer, the lack of pricing and detailed scope information on the public website means that a significant amount of due diligence must be done after the initial inquiry. Eduoptionsint.com Review

It requires proactive questioning and careful review of any provided proposals.
